Solution Architect Job Description: Top Duties and Qualifications

A Solution Architect, or IT Solution Architect, is responsible for using their knowledge of computer systems to help their employer solve business problems. Their duties include working closely with IT professionals to develop and integrate computer systems, reviewing existing systems to identify areas for improvement and monitoring the outcome of new or upgraded systems on business operations.

Build a Job Description

Solution Architect Duties and Responsibilities

A Solution Architect manages a number of responsibilities. These may include:  

  • Conducting an evaluation of the computer system architecture with an emphasis on the design 
  • Analyzing the system throughout the enterprise system
  • Creating and maintaining or enhancing procedures, processes and designs for a computer system 
  • Ensuring that the application architecture team can deliver system solutions for computer architecture. 
Build a Job Description

Solution Architect Job Description Examples

What Does a Solution Architect Do?

Solution Architects typically work for corporations across industries, but they can also work for specialized IT or software firms to perform outsourced work. They communicate with their team members to determine the best methods to overcome business problems using computer software. Their job is to meet with clients or business management to determine current concerns for the company and identify how the implementation of computer systems can help solve problems. They may also be responsible for identifying future business needs and preemptively planning for system integrations or changes.

Solution Architect Skills and Qualifications

Solution architect skills include:

  • Identifying, testing and managing risk: They must identify and evaluate the risk to eliminate or mitigate risk in a computer system or network.
  • Knowledge of software development process and technical skills: Solution Architects must know the technical aspects of projects to identify risks, propose immediate solutions and provide guidance for the computer system solutions.
  • Communication skills: To communicate with all stakeholders such as software engineers, management, clients and vendors, they must convey technical language to other stakeholders often in non-technical terms.
  • Project management skills: To manage and train staff for software projects and computer architecture projects in a team environment.
  • Organizational and time management skills: To keep projects on schedule and within budget.
  • Broad knowledge: Of computer software, hardware and computer languages.

Solution Architect Salary Expectations

The average salary for a Solution Architect is $142,864 per year. Salary estimates are based on salaries submitted to Indeed by Solution Architect employees and users, as well as being collected from past and present job advertisements on Indeed. Solution Architect compensation may vary according to the seniority of the Solution Architect with compensation and benefits for a Solution Architect being at a higher rate for those Solution Architects with several years of work experience. The size of the business or organization will also determine salary rates.  

Solution Architect Education and Training Requirements

A Solution Architect should have a bachelor’s degree or higher. The core education of a Solution Architect should be in computer science, information technology or software engineering. After completing this education, Solution Architects can gain further certification in their field from Microsoft and other information technology companies in their chosen specialties. Conferences and networking experiences add to a Solution Architect’s education, career potential and earning ability. 

Solution Architect Experience Requirements

Being a Solution Architect is not an entry-level role for information technology professionals. The role of a Solution Architect requires a person who has at least five to ten years of network administration and at least three to five years of additional experience with computer systems, operating systems, security for computer systems and management of databases with experience with hardware and software management. The more senior Solution Architect roles will require that someone has worked consistently five or more years in a network administration, information technology or software development role. Some Solution Architect positions may require management, training, supervising and mentoring experience if the person focuses their work as a Solution Architect project manager or senior Solution Architect role.

Job Description Samples for Similar Positions

The Solution Architect position is a broad and loosely defined job description for various information technology positions, instead of a single job title and job description. Some of the positions that are associated with the title, experience, education and duties of a Solution Architect description and position are:

Ready to Hire a Solution Architect? Build a Solution Architect Job Description

Frequently asked questions about Solution Architects

What is the difference between a Solution Architect and an Enterprise Architect?

The difference between a Solution Architect and an Enterprise Architect is their areas of job focus. For example, Solution Architects focus on refining existing software or implementing new technologies to combat a variety of business problems. These could include limited communication channels, data loss or inaccessibility and information security.

In contrast, Enterprise Architects focus on performing routine maintenance on existing software or network systems in a business. This includes replacing hardware devices as necessary, upgrading software programs, installing malware detection devices and monitoring data back-up systems. Software Architects may work closely with Enterprise Architects to ensure effective business operations through the implementation of software programs.


What are the daily duties of a Solution Architect?

On a typical day, a Solution Architect starts by checking their email and voicemail to respond to important messages from business leaders, coworkers or clients. They participate in meetings with the IT department and department heads to gauge their business’s needs and learn more about factors affecting communication, productivity or employee satisfaction. Throughout the day. Solution Architects divide their time between visiting departments to help them set-up new software and strategizing with their team about upcoming projects. 

They use downtime at their desk to monitor company data channels to identify issues. They also use this time to make surveys or polls to gauge technology needs.


What qualities make a good Solution Architect?

A good Solution Architect has excellent interpersonal communication. This quality enables them to adjust their communication to speak with company personnel who don’t come from an IT background. They value continued education, and always look for ways to improve their understanding of IT technologies and how they can benefit businesses. Further, a good Solution Architect has superb attention to detail, helping them identify trends in business operations and develop IT solutions accordingly. A good Solution Architect also enjoys working as part of a team and encourages their teammates’ ideas on how to approach organizational problems.


Who does a Solution Architect report to?

A Solution Architect usually reports to a Senior Solution Architect within their team, or the Solution Department Manager. These individuals set objectives for Solution Architects to work toward and provide them with experience-based guidance in their daily job activities. When Solution Architects work for specialized technology firms, they typically report to the Firm Manager or the client themselves. 

Job Description Examples

Need help writing a job description for a specific role? Use these job description examples to create your next great job posting. Or if you’re ready to hire, post your job on Indeed.

No search results found